Please let me hijack this thread for a second, since this came up in a reply:
There is a misconception that Edius is weak for documentary work...this is absolutely wrong. Nearly all my work is documentaries or documentary-style information films. I use Edius exclusively, and my films have won many awards, been in many festivals, and excerpted on TV, so Edius totally fits documentary filmmaking...long form as well as short-form.
I just completed an 18 minute piece and the one before that was an hour-long. The speed is quite the thing, with rendering only needed occasionally if I use multiple 3-D keyers for a special need...I continue to work in Edius 3.62 and Storm, so, yes I am using SD resolution (although I shoot in HDV and down-rez).
I am eager to see what version 5 brings as I contemplate stepping up to a new system (currently I use a 3.0 P4). I am under some pressure to move to FCP since my son (a 25-year old!) uses FCP exclusively and is eager to swap projects with me so we can work back and forth. If there is an easy solution to doing this without jumping ship, that's what I want!!

You could buy a Mac Pro with bootacamp and use Edius 5 on the Windows side. You also can put FCP on the Apple side so that projects can be swapped. Apple to Apple, Edius to Edius. Files are not seen by each other. I do believe that there is a way, but I do not know the name of the program that allows that.
